Twenty years after cultivating a new orientation for aesthetics via the concept of nonphotography, Franois Laruelle returns, having further developed his notion of a nonstandard aesthetics. Published for the first time in a bilingual edition, PhotoFiction, a NonStandard Aesthetics expounds on Laruelles current explorations into a photographic thinking as an alternative to the wornout notions of aesthetics based on an assumed domination of philosophy over art. He proposes a new philosophical photofictional apparatus, or philofiction, that strives for a discursive mimesis of the photographic apparatus and the flash of the Real entailed in its process of image making. A bit like if an artisan, to use a Socratic example, instead of making a camera based off of diagrams found in manuals, on the contrary had as his or her project the designing of a completely new apparatus of philofiction, thus capable of producing not simply photos, but photofictions. One must enter into a space for seeing the vectorial and the imaginary number. Laruelles philofictions become not art installations, but theoretical installations calling for the consideration of the possibility of a nonstandard aesthetics being of an equal or superior power to art and philosophy, an aesthetics inthelastinstance that is itself an inventive and creative act of the most contemporary kind.
